Delhi government on Tuesday claimed that there is no shortage of essential commodities in violence-hit Trilokpuri area and special arrangements are also being made to provide these commodities to residents at reasonable prices.

"There is no shortage of essential commodities in Trilok Puri area. We are maintaining a very close vigil on the availability and the prices of essential commodities like rice, atta, dals, vegetables, milk etc.in this area in close coordination with SAFAL and Mother Dairy," SS Yadav, commissioner of Food & Supply Department, said. Yadav said that special arrangements have been made by Delhi Government in collaboration with Mother Dairy, SAFAL and Delhi State Civil Supplies Corporation Limited (DSCSC) to provide essential commodities at reasonable prices.

He said that Department has constituted ten teams of legal metrology officers. These teams are taking rounds of the area and keeping a close watch on the prices. Strict action is being taken against traders indulging in overcharging, hoarding and other malpractices to cheat the consumers. "SAFAL has opened additional stalls in various pockets of this area to make available onions, potatoes and fresh vegetables, pulses are also being sold at these counters.

"Mobile vegetable vans have also been pressed into service. Availability of milk is being ensured by Mother Dairy both at its booth as well as mobile milk vans. There is no shortage in supply of milk," Yadav added. Yadav also added that DSCSC has also taken initiatives to provide essential commodities in Trilok Puri area.

"Six mobile vans have been pressed into service which are providing these essential commodities to the people at reasonable rates. The Department has also ensured that all the 34 ration shops in the Trilok Puri area remain open and disburse ration to the beneficiaries. Opening of LPG agencies has also been ensured to avoid any inconvenience to the people," he further added.
